эффект покрытия потока для списка PDF - PullRequest
2 голосов
/ 25 августа 2011

Я хотел знать, как мы можем реализовать эффект потока обложки для списка PDF-файлов, и при двойном нажатии он должен открыть соответствующий PDF-файл.Я действительно поражен между, пожалуйста, помогите мне

спасибо заранее

Ответы [ 2 ]

3 голосов
/ 26 августа 2011

При поиске в файле openFlowView.m этот метод

- (void)awakeFromNib {
    [self setUpInitialState];
}
Now when you find this replace this method by below or add lines of tapGestureRecognizer.

- (void)awakeFromNib {
    [self setUpInitialState];
    UITapGestureRecognizer *tapRecognizer = [[UITapGestureRecognizer alloc] initWithTarget:self action:@selector(screenTapped:)];   
    [tapRecognizer setNumberOfTapsRequired:2];
    [self addGestureRecognizer:tapRecognizer];
    [tapRecognizer release];    

}
screenTapped is my method that gets called when I tap twice on cover flow.

- (void)screenTapped:(UITapGestureRecognizer *)tap {
    NSLog(@"Screen tapped");
//put your points of your coverflow coordinates
    if(coverPointimage.x > 0 && coverPointimage.x <= 265 && coverPointimage.y >0 && coverPointimage.y <= 205){
        [self imageClicked];//either write code or made seperate method that should gets called when you do double tap.
    }


}

Надеюсь, этот код сэкономит вам пару часов. Счастливое кодирование.

1 голос
/ 25 августа 2011

Вы должны попробовать Tapku Library для эффекта coverflow. Это действительно легко и настраиваемо. Вы можете найти это здесь .

...